Green Path Forgotten Food Restaurent Why go here? Come eat at this restaurent, if you're looking to have a quiet time eating healthy and tasty food with your family and special ones. Location 5/5 : Right opposite Mantri Mall Metro Station It's on a busy, prominent street. Easy to find and a good place to visit if you're in the Malleshwaram area. Reaching here is very easy by public transport. There is also a parking space for cars. Parking : Space for cars and two-wheelers. There is beautiful murals inside the parking lot. Check the images attached. 3 storeyed building, where the Ground floor is a serene cafe. Second floor is a conference room type space. Third floor is the Forgotten Foods Multi-Cuisine Restaurent. Mostly, it is an ala carte place. But, special mention to a Lunch Buffet that will be there only on Saturday & Sunday. It's a great deal and you get to try out almost the entire selection of their organic vegetarian menu. Priced at 450 + taxes per person. Food : We tried the Weekend Buffet, which was delicious. It had North Indian and South Indian selections. Soup, Millet Khichadi, Vegetable Curry, Tandoori Roti, Maharaja Pulao, Pasta, Sandwiches & more. There were around 5 kinds of dessert, including a homemade ice cream. Overall, the place is a must-visit. I'm giving 4 stars. Highlights : Great concept, surprisingly tasty organic food, nature-inspired interiors, comfortable space. Taking 1 star away because of bad music choice in the background. Old bollywood instrumentals were being played, which made it seem as if we're attending a marriage lunch. Music could be a little more soothing, perhaps acoustic guitar or meditative nature sounds.

Ramesh Ganeshan
When one is a LAZY human being, a foodie, and a sucker for delicious healthy food that one's grandma used to talk about from her younger days, one prefers going to the place offering their patronage consistently and devotedly instead of writing a review for it. Such a customer simply prefers going all the way to the restaurant, come blistering afternoon heat, or a cool, rainy evening to sitting at home and writing a review that may or may not be read by a handful of people.<br/><br/>Personally, I've visited this 'organic' heaven countless times ever since it started with my family, and continue to do so time and again.<br/><br/>The ambience of the entire building appeals to the inner sense of gladness in everyone who walks in. There is an aura of a warm, familiar, wholesome feeling everywhere in this establishment, with a smiling workforce who try their best to accommodate any requests by guests.<br/><br/>Even the Cafe situated on the ground floor is a nice place to hang out in the afternoons offering healthy nibbles and a nice array of health drinks, steeps, and brews that are rejuvenating elixirs for tired senses/body systems.<br/><br/>Two floors above, is a beautifully thought out, nature-rich, organic vegetarian restaurant serving predominantly buffet-meals. Howsoever picky one may be of South Indian cuisine, one can easily find something on the spread that one can savour and treasure.<br/><br/>Right from the starters, thru the main course, right up to the desserts, guests are lavished with traditional, rustic, health-minded dishes that appeal not just to the palate, but to the other senses as well, and mainly to the soul. There's just something wonderful about the usage of traditional (lesser known or even lesser used) foodgrains like millets and unpolished red rice as standard fare served each day included in soups, mains, or even in the desserts that ushers in some interesting textures, flavours, and tastes.<br/><br/>Yup, even a dessert or two here contain millets! And for the calorie-conscious, sweet-tooths (and even diabetics like me) among us, the sweetener is usually jaggery or even palm jaggery that makes the desserts light, sweet, and yet flavourful.<br/><br/>Besides the scrumptious 'default' meals offered, there are menu surprises like multigrain and millet organic pizzas available (in the evenings)...and I believe they are delicious. I've hosted a birthday party in one of the hall/event spaces in the building, for my daughter with an organic fruit-and-millets birthday cake, and the pizzas among the eats served, and they were an outright hit at the party, as I didn't get a single piece as my Guestlist finished the running stock of pizzas that evening! Talk about luck!!<br/><br/>But, all said and done, as a family, we love this place for it's culinary delights, and as a bonus, we even do our organic provisions and vegetables shopping in the in-house store on the ground floor within the premises.
